What's involved –
Manage the provision of physiotherapy services to eligible clients within the Central West Hospital and Health Service (CWHHS).
The Physiotherapist - Senior will participate as an active member in multidisciplinary health teams with particular emphasis on the delivery, promotion, and advocacy of physiotherapy services within the CWHHS areas
About Central West Hospital and Health Service -
Our diverse and rewarding work environment is as unique and dynamic as Central West Queensland itself.
Our far-reaching health services cover a region of almost 20.6 percent of Queensland, encompasses seven local government areas, and reaches 18 unique and lively communities.
Expansive in the true sense of the word, the region opens current horizons painted in red earth, blue sky and burnt orange sunsets.
It might feel miles away from urban life, but we are just a two-hour flight from Brisbane – well within reach of the city and South East Queensland's beautiful beaches.

It is a condition of employment for this role for the employee to be, and remain, vaccinated against measles, mumps, rubella, varicella and hepatitis B during their employment.
